About Tukarali:

Tukarali is a Portuguese-speaking country which was built and developed by immigrants from Artania, Seleya, Majatra and Dovani. In this regard, it can be considered to be a "settler nation-state" like the United States of America, Brazil, Australia and Argentina, but even more ethnically diverse. In short, the Lusitanians (Portuguese-speaking people who originated from Darnussia and its islands) moved to what is now known as Tukarali in order to flee measures taken in Darnussia to Artanianise (Germanise) the country. Fleeing persecution, the Lusitanians established the Tukarese state but quickly adopted a liberal immigration policy in order to encourage more people to arrive to develop the country. This explains the diverse ethnic composition of Tukarali.

Guidelines:

• The names of political parties should be in Portuguese
• The names of vast majority of characters/'candidates'/politicians should be Portuguese
• A small number of Portuguese names mixed with Italian/African/Japanese/Iranian/Chinese/French/Afrikaaner/English first or surnames may be permitted, but it is suggested these are mixed with Portuguese forenames or surnames
